Physical Safety
The most obvious reason for learning self-defense techniques is physical safety. Individuals can defend themselves from attackers and physical harm by learning how to protect themselves. Self-defense techniques include basic moves such as punches, kicks, and blocks and more advanced techniques such as grappling and submissions. With regular practice, individuals can improve their physical abilities, build muscle memory, and become better prepared to handle real-life situations.
Mental Toughness
Self-defense training is not just about learning physical techniques; it also builds mental toughness. Through training, individuals can learn to stay calm and focused in high-stress situations. The ability to stay composed and make rational decisions in dangerous situations is essential for personal safety. Self-defense training teaches individuals to remain calm, assess situations, and make smart decisions under pressure.

Fitness
Self-defense training is an excellent way to improve physical fitness. It requires a lot of physical activity and can help individuals improve their cardiovascular health, strength, and flexibility. The training can also help individuals maintain a healthy weight and reduce their risk of chronic diseases such as obesity, heart disease, and diabetes. Self-defense training is a great way to stay in shape and maintain a healthy lifestyle.
